Werk #17399: Sawtooth pattern in cached SNMP interface graphs

Component Checks & agents
Title Sawtooth pattern in cached SNMP interface graphs
Date Nov 26, 2024
Level Trivial Change
Class Bug Fix
Compatibility Incompatible - Manual interaction might be required
Checkmk versions & editions
2.4.0b1
Not yet released
Checkmk Raw (CRE), Checkmk Enterprise (CEE), Checkmk Cloud (CCE), Checkmk MSP (CME)
2.3.0p22 Checkmk Raw (CRE), Checkmk Enterprise (CEE), Checkmk Cloud (CCE), Checkmk MSP (CME)

This only affects users that configured the rule "Fetch intervals for SNMP sections" for the section "if64".

If users configured a custom fetch interval for this section, but not for the "uptime" section, the service graphs would exhibit a sawtooth pattern. Measured values would jump between zero and a too large value (by a factor proportional to the configured interval).

This is fixed now, and the reported values are correct. Note that the graph will still have interruptions, as correct rates can only be computed when new SNMP data is fetched and not inbetween.

Affected users might want to disable this rule during the upgrade, as the service will crash until the section has been fetched again.

To the list of all Werks